Summary
- Asset classes: Top Gold +5.18% vs. Bottom Bitcoin USD −14.37% vs. All Country World Index −0.18%
- Countries: Top Brazil +6.63% vs. Bottom Korea, Republic of −9.83% vs. All Country World Index −0.18%
- Volatility: Short-Term 16.35 vs. Medium-Term 22.10 vs. 10-Year Average 18.48
- Currencies: Top GBP Index +0.79% vs. Bottom JPY Index −1.46%
- US sectors: Top Health Care +9.14% vs. Bottom Technology −5.20% vs. S&P-500 Index +0.03%
- pfolio portfolios: Top Stock - ESG - High Volatility +6.00% vs. Bottom ETF - Crypto - High Volatility −1.67% vs. All Country World Index −0.18%

Asset classes
Good month for gold and fixed income, with equities mostly flat or in the red; Bitcoin continued its decline, dropping 14.37% this month.

Country equity markets
Brazil topped the country equity markets ranking with a 6.63% return; South Korea lost around half of last month's gains.

Volatility
Short-term volatility closed low and below the 10-year average of 18.48. Volatility spiked to a high of 26.42 and then sharply dropped back low levels.

Currencies
The British Pound and the Euro strengthened at the expense of the Japanese Yen.

US sectors
Eight out of 11 US sectors in the green this month, with Health Care in the number one spot and Technology lagging for once.
